Broker Reviews

Broker reviews are an essential tool for investors looking to make informed decisions when choosing a broker to manage their investments. These reviews provide valuable insight into the reputation, services, and performance of various brokers in the market. By reading broker reviews, investors can assess the credibility and reliability of a broker before entrusting them with their hard-earned money.

One key aspect that broker reviews cover is the broker’s reputation. This includes factors such as how long the broker has been in business, whether they are regulated by a reputable authority, and any past disciplinary actions taken against them. A broker’s reputation is crucial as it speaks to their trustworthiness and reliability in handling investors’ funds. By reading reviews from other investors, potential clients can get a sense of whether a broker has a solid reputation or if there are any red flags that warrant further investigation.

In addition to reputation, broker reviews also evaluate the services offered by brokers. This includes the range of investment products available, trading platforms, customer support, and fees. Investors need to consider what services are important to them and whether a broker’s offerings align with their investment goals and preferences.

Furthermore, broker reviews often assess the performance of brokers in terms of investment returns and customer satisfaction. Investors want to know how well a broker has performed in helping clients achieve their financial goals and whether they have a track record of success. By reading reviews from other investors, potential clients can gauge whether a broker has a history of delivering positive results and providing excellent customer service.

It is important for investors to approach broker reviews with a critical mindset and consider multiple sources before making a decision. While reviews can provide valuable insights, they may also be biased or influenced by individual experiences. Therefore, investors should read a variety of reviews from different sources to get a well-rounded perspective on a broker’s reputation, services, and performance.
